Heaven gained it’s best Sawyer & Logger on Monday August 11, 2025 at the age of 83. Jim L. Bivens built a business that runs generations deep. He loved to wheel and deal in timber and land deals. Daddy would go on the hunt for a log not knowing the exact location but say when he got out in the woods, he could “smell it” and locate it- He actually did that! He was simple and larger than life. He was the provider, protector and foundation of his family. The wisdom and guidance he gave was unmatched. You could always count on a good cowboy and western to be on the TV when you came in. He will be forever missed. He was the real life Marlboro Man and our Hero.
